Currency Pair Outlook

Understanding Currency Pair Outlook

  • The Currency Pair Outlook refers to the analysis of different currency pairs in the forex market, considering factors such as economic indicators, market sentiment, and geopolitical events.
  • It's essential for traders to understand the strengths and weaknesses of currencies when selecting pairs to maximize profits.
  • Analysts often use various tools and indicators to assess currency strength and forecast potential movements.
  • Key Factors Influencing Currency Pairs

  • Economic Data: Reports on employment, inflation, and GDP can sway currency prices significantly.
  • Central Bank Policies: Decisions on interest rates and monetary policy by institutions like the ECB or the Fed can impact currency strength.
  • Geopolitical Events: Factors such as elections, trade disputes, and international relations can create volatility in currency pairs. 🌍

  • Examples of Popular Currency Pairs

  • EUR/USD: This pair is influenced by economic data from the Eurozone and the U.S., making it a staple for many traders.
  • GBP/JPY: Highly volatile, this pair reflects fluctuations based on UK political events and Japanese economic data.
  • AUD/USD: Commodity prices significantly impact this pair, especially given Australia's exports of minerals and agricultural products.
  • Trading Strategies Based on Currency Pair Outlook

  • Trend Following: Traders can identify and capitalize on existing trends in currency pairs using strength indicators.
  • Mean Reversion: This strategy posits that currency prices will return to their historical mean, allowing traders to seek entry points when currencies straddle key levels.
  • News Trading: Anticipating market movements based on upcoming economic reports or geopolitical events can guide decisive trades. πŸ“Š
